CDS CDS Wiki Tron Nedir: Gelişmiş Merkeziyetsiz Blockchain Platformu
CDS Wiki

Tron Nedir: Gelişmiş Merkeziyetsiz Blockchain Platformu

TRON is an ambitious project dedicated to the establishment of a truly decentralized Internet and its infrastructured.

199
Tron Explained: Advanced Decentralized Blockchain Platform

TRON, iddialı taahhüdüyle gerçekten merkezi olmayan bir İnternet ve altyapısına ulaşmayı hedefliyor. Küresel olarak en kapsamlı blockchain tabanlı işletim sistemlerinden biri olarak kabul edilen TRON Protokolü, TRON ekosistemindeki tüm Merkezi Olmayan Uygulamalar (DApp’ler) için sağlam genel blockchain yardımı sağlar. Bu destek, olağanüstü düzeyde verim, ölçeklenebilirlik ve kullanılabilirlik sağlar.

Tron Nedir: Gelişmiş Merkeziyetsiz Blockchain Platformu

Tron Nedir: Gelişmiş Merkeziyetsiz Blockchain Platformu

Tron, blok zinciri teknolojisi üzerine kurulu, Tronix veya TRX olarak bilinen kendi kripto para birimini sunan merkezi olmayan bir dijital platformdur. Singapur merkezli kar amacı gütmeyen bir kuruluş olan Tron Foundation tarafından 2017 yılında kurulan Tron’un birincil hedefi, dijital içeriğin uygun maliyetli paylaşımını kolaylaştıran küresel bir eğlence sistemi oluşturmaktır.

Blockchain ve eşler arası (P2P) ağ teknolojisinden yararlanan Tron, aracıları ortadan kaldırarak içerik oluşturucuların çalışmalarını tüketicilere doğrudan satmalarını sağlar. Geliştiriciler, Tron platformunda barındırılan uygulamaları oluşturmak için Solidity programlama dilini kullanır.

Tronix (TRX), kullanıcıların uygulamalarına erişim için içerik oluşturuculara doğrudan ödeme yapmasına izin vererek ağ içinde para birimi olarak hizmet eder. Tron’un içerik oluşturuculardan işlem ücreti talep etmemesi, onu uygun maliyetli bir çözüm haline getiriyor. Ayrıca platformda TRX işlemleri ücretsizdir.

Kullanıcılar, kripto varlıklarını masaüstü, mobil veya donanım cüzdanları dahil olmak üzere çeşitli cüzdanlarda saklama seçeneğine sahiptir.

Mimari

Tron Nedir: Gelişmiş Merkeziyetsiz Blockchain Platformu

TRON, Depolama Katmanı, Çekirdek Katmanı ve Uygulama Katmanından oluşan 3 katmanlı bir mimari kullanır. Birden çok dili desteklemek için TRON protokolü, dil uzantısını doğal olarak kolaylaştıran Google Protobuf’u kullanır.

Çekirdek Katman, akıllı sözleşmeler, hesap yönetimi ve fikir birliği gibi çeşitli modüllerden oluşur. TRON, optimize edilmiş bir komut seti ile yığın tabanlı bir sanal makine uygular. Solidity, gelişmiş dillerin gelecekteki desteğine yönelik planlarla DApp geliştiricilerine daha iyi yardımcı olmak için akıllı sözleşme dili olarak seçildi.

TRON’un mutabakat mekanizması, Delegated Proof of Stake’e (DPoS) dayanmaktadır ve benzersiz gereksinimlerini karşılamak için çok sayıda yenilik yapılmıştır.

TRON, Blok Depolama ve Durum Depolamadan oluşan benzersiz bir dağıtılmış depolama protokolü geliştirdi. Depolama katmanı, gerçek dünyadaki çeşitlendirilmiş veri depolama ihtiyaçlarını karşılamak için bir grafik veritabanı kavramını içerir. Geliştiriciler, TRON platformunda çok çeşitli DApp’ler ve özelleştirilmiş cüzdanlar oluşturma esnekliğine sahiptir. Akıllı sözleşmelerin TRON üzerinde konuşlandırılması ve yürütülmesi, sınırsız yardımcı uygulama fırsatları sağlar.

TRON protokolü, yapılandırılmış verileri iletişim protokolleri ve veri depolama dahil olmak üzere çeşitli amaçlar için serileştirmenin dilden bağımsız ve platformdan bağımsız bir yöntemi olan Google Protocol Buffers’a bağlıdır.

TRON Sanal Makinesi (TVM), TRON’un ekosistemi için özel olarak tasarlanmış, hafif ve Turing eksiksiz bir sanal makinedir. Mevcut geliştirme ekosistemiyle sorunsuz bir şekilde bütünleşerek dünya çapında milyonlarca geliştiriciye verimli, kullanışlı, istikrarlı, güvenli ve ölçeklenebilir bir blockchain sistemi sağlar.

TRON ağı, doğası gereği birden fazla ticaret çiftinden oluşan merkezi olmayan değişim işlevlerini destekler. Bu ticaret çiftleri, TRC-10 belirteçlerini veya TRC-10 belirteçleri ile TRX’in bir kombinasyonunu içerebilir. TRON ağında benzer bir çift zaten mevcut olsa bile, herhangi bir hesap bir ticaret çifti oluşturabilir.

Ticaret ve fiyat dalgalanmaları Bancor Protokolünü takip eder. TRON ağı, tüm ticaret çiftlerinde her iki token için eşit ağırlıklar belirleyerek, aralarındaki denge oranına dayalı olarak fiyat oranını belirler.

TRON blok zinciri Java’da uygulanır ve başlangıçta çatallanma yoluyla EthereumJ’den türetilir.

Tron Nedir: Gelişmiş Merkeziyetsiz Blockchain Platformu

Tron Sanal Makinesi (TVM)

TRON Sanal Makinesi (TVM), TRON ekosistemi için özel olarak tasarlanmış eksiksiz bir Turing sanal makinesidir. Birincil amacı, verimlilik, rahatlık, kararlılık, güvenlik ve ölçeklenebilirlik sergileyen özel olarak oluşturulmuş bir blockchain sistemi sağlamaktır.

Başlangıçta EVM’den türetilen TVM, mevcut Solidity akıllı sözleşme geliştirme ekosistemiyle sorunsuz bir şekilde bütünleşir. Solidity’ye ek olarak TVM, DPoS mutabakatını da destekler.

TVM, EVM’de kullanılan Gaz mekanizmasından farklı olan Enerji kavramını sunar. TVM’deki işlemler ve akıllı sözleşme işlemleri ücretsizdir ve TRX tüketmez. TVM’nin hesaplama kapasitesi, tutulan toplam token miktarı ile sınırlı değildir.

Derleyici, Solidity akıllı sözleşmelerini TVM’de okunabilen ve yürütülebilen bayt koduna çevirir. TVM, yığın tabanlı bir sonlu durum makinesine benzer şekilde işlev gören işlem kodları aracılığıyla verileri işler. Blok zinciri verilerine erişir ve Birlikte Çalışma katmanı aracılığıyla Harici Veri Arayüzünü çağırır.

TVM, kaynak tüketimini en aza indirmek ve sistem performansını sağlamak için hafif bir mimari izler. TRX aktarımları ve akıllı sözleşme yürütme, TRX’in kendisi yerine yalnızca bant genişliği noktaları gerektirir, bu da TRON’u saldırılara karşı daha az duyarlı hale getirir. Her hesaplama adımının önceden belirlenmiş bir maliyeti olduğundan, bant genişliği tüketimi tahmin edilebilir ve sabittir.

TVM, EVM ile uyumludur ve gelecekte diğer ana akım sanal makinelerle de uyumlu olacaktır. Bu uyumluluk, EVM için geliştirilen tüm akıllı sözleşmelerin TVM üzerinde yürütülmesine olanak tanır. TVM’nin bant genişliği kurulumuyla, geliştirme maliyetleri azaltılarak geliştiricilerin sözleşme kodlarının mantıksal gelişimine odaklanmaları sağlanır. TVM ayrıca sözleşme dağıtımı, tetikleme ve görüntüleme için kapsamlı arabirimler sunarak geliştiricilere kolaylık sunar.

Daha fazla wiki makalesine erişmek için: cryptodataspace.com

Written by
Aziz KARTAL

Aziz Kartal is 21 years old. He is a student at the Gazi University, Department of Electrical and Electronical Engineering. He works as content writer, researcher and social media manager. He generally research about Web3, Blockchain Security and Cybersecurity.

Leave a comment

Bir yanıt yazın

Related Articles

Immutable X: NFT Dünyasında Devrim Yaratan Katman 2 Çözümü

Immutable X: NFT Dünyasında Devrim Yaratan Katman 2 Çözümü

Origin Protocol: Merkeziyetsiz Ticarette Yeni Bir Dönem

Origin Protocol, blokzincir ve OGN token ile eşler arası ticareti güvenli hale...

OMG Network: Kapsamlı Rehber

OMG Network: Kapsamlı Rehber

Enzyme Finance: Merkeziyetsiz Varlık Yönetim Platformunun Geleceği

Enzyme Finance merkeziyetsiz ticaret protokolü ve Ethereum üzerinde varlık yönetimi